Born & raised in Hialeah Orion, is the son of two Cuban immigrants who came here to escape the communist dictatorship that took over their homeland. Hiphop culture consumed Orion at an early age amercing himself in the graffiti aspect of it first. It wasn’t until much later that he would pick up the mic. He graduated from Full Sail in September of 2002 obtaining an associates degree in recording engineering.

In 2004 with his group Secret Service he released an EP entitled “Protecting Dead Presidents” it was an independent venture which circulated the streets of Miami for some time. Performing at night clubs, concerts, open mics, and any special event he can get to perform at. In 2006 he partnered with One Take, and Ephnik to release a compilation entitled “The Movement vol.1 diffusing the science.” The compilation gained praised throughout Miami, and the Internet. Several reviews, interviews, and features were done on the project. Independently its sold close to 3,000 units most of which was either done by the Internet, or on the street.

Orion began sharing the stage with Elastic Bond a fusion band based out of Miami. It was instant chemistry with the addition of Orion in the group December 2007 slated the release of Elastic Bond’s 2nd album “Excursion.” The band remains busy performing gigs at a constant basis in Miami, and has garnered praise from publications such as The Miami New times. The band offers a blend of Hiphop, jazz, R&B, Electronica, and an assortment of Latin rhythms.
